Rename File in a Different Folder
Show older comments
Hey all,
I am trying to use the movefile command to rename a file using variables and current date.
If I use this code and the REPORT.txt is located in the working folder, it works absolutely fine:
movefile('REPORT.txt', fullfile(prjNo + 'REPORT'+ date +'.txt'));
However, the file I am trying to rename is located in a subfolder of the working folder. I have tried the following options but none of them works:
% Option 1:
movefile('OUT\REPORT.txt', fullfile(prjNo + 'REPORT'+ date +'.txt'));
% Option 2:
movefile(fullfile(workingfolder, + 'OUT\REPORT.txt'), fullfile(prjNo + 'REPORT'+ date +'.txt'));
Can someone point out where the problem is or offer an elegant alternative solution please?
Many thanks.

I don't think you fully understand how fullfile works. It will put your separate inputs together to form a valid path string, taking the difference between Unix/Linux/Mac and Windows into account.
You only provided a single input. Inputs in Matlab are not separated by the plus symbol, but with a comma symbol.
You should use sprintf to create the name of the file, then use fullfile to combine the file name and folder names.
